A person shall not cause or knowingly permit his or her child or ward under the age of 18 years to drive a motor vehicle upon any highway when the minor is not authorized under the provisions of NRS 483.010 to 483.630, inclusive, or is in violation of any of the provisions of NRS 483.010 to 483.630, inclusive, or if the minor’s license is revoked or suspended pursuant to title 5 of NRS or NRS 392.148. It is a misdemeanor for a person to violate this section.

Terms Used In Nevada Revised Statutes 483.580

  • person: means a natural person, any form of business or social organization and any other nongovernmental legal entity including, but not limited to, a corporation, partnership, association, trust or unincorporated organization. See Nevada Revised Statutes 0.039
